Core Viewpoint - JD Logistics has shown significant revenue growth and profitability improvements, driven by external customer expansion and enhanced service offerings, particularly through its integrated supply chain solutions [1][2][3]. Revenue and Profitability - In 2024, JD Logistics reported revenue of 182.84 billion, a year-on-year increase of 9.7%, and a net profit of 7.09 billion, reflecting a remarkable year-on-year growth of 507% [1]. - For Q1 2025, the revenue was 46.97 billion, up 11.5% year-on-year, with a net profit of 610 million, marking an 89.5% increase [2]. Customer Base and Service Offerings - The company has focused on expanding its external customer base, with a notable shift in revenue sources. By 2023, revenue from external customers reached 116.56 billion, accounting for 70% of total revenue [12][14]. - The integrated supply chain service, while a key product, has seen its revenue share decrease as more external customers opt for other service options [11][9]. Cost Management and Profit Margins - JD Logistics has improved its gross profit margins significantly, with the gross profit margin reaching 10.2% in 2024, up from 2.9% in 2018 [22][24]. - The reduction in outsourcing costs has also contributed to the improved profit margins, with outsourcing costs as a percentage of revenue decreasing from 38.5% in 2021 to 34.6% in 2024 [25]. Financial Health and Cash Flow - The company has transitioned from a cost center to a profit center since its independence in 2017, contributing one-sixth of JD Group's profits in 2024 [49][50]. - Operating cash flow exceeded 20 billion in 2024, indicating a strong financial position and reduced debt burden [48]. Logistics Infrastructure and Strategy - JD Logistics has invested heavily in building a robust logistics infrastructure, including over 1,600 warehouses and 20,000 delivery stations, enhancing its last-mile delivery capabilities [43][41]. - The company has also focused on improving its transportation capabilities through acquisitions and partnerships, significantly increasing its fleet size and operational efficiency [40][38].

Core Viewpoint - The revised "Express Delivery Temporary Regulations" will take effect on June 1, introducing a dedicated chapter on "express packaging," which addresses the regulatory gap in packaging management and supports the green development of the express delivery industry [1]. Group 1: Industry Growth and Challenges - China's express delivery industry has entered the era of over 100 billion packages, with an expected volume exceeding 1.75 trillion packages in 2024, representing a year-on-year growth of 21.5% [1]. - The rapid growth of express delivery services has led to significant usage and disposal of packaging materials, making packaging management a crucial task for the industry's high-quality development [1]. Group 2: Green Transformation Efforts - The regulations encourage the adoption of new technologies and materials to develop environmentally friendly packaging [2]. - The packaging waste primarily consists of product packaging, e-commerce packaging, and delivery service packaging, with a focus on reducing, recycling, and upgrading packaging materials [2]. - Companies like Jingxing Packaging are utilizing recycled materials to produce corrugated paper, achieving a consumption rate of approximately 1.1 tons of waste cardboard for every ton of new paper produced [2]. Group 3: Innovations in Packaging - Companies are developing biodegradable tape and reusable packaging solutions, such as Zhongtong's "multi-life" boxes designed for frequent returns [3]. - The introduction of intelligent packaging systems has improved packaging efficiency, with original direct shipping increasing from about 5% to 25% in recent years, and projected to reach 40% [5][6]. - The use of smart recommendations for packaging materials has led to a 20% reduction in material usage across nearly 300 warehouses [6]. Group 4: Recycling and Circular Economy - The establishment of recycling facilities at delivery points is crucial for closing the packaging management loop [7]. - Initiatives like the "return box plan" at Zhejiang University have resulted in 90% of used boxes being recycled for further use, significantly reducing waste [8]. - The shift from a linear model of "manufacture-use-dispose" to a circular model of "production-consumption-recycling-reuse" is being accelerated through enhanced end-of-life management practices [8][9]. Group 5: Regulatory Framework and Future Directions - The regulations clarify the responsibilities of various stakeholders in the green governance of packaging, marking a significant step in the legal and standard implementation system [9]. - The National Postal Administration plans to promote a series of standards and policies to guide innovation in packaging products, technologies, and models, further advancing the green transformation of the express delivery sector [9].

Core Insights - The logistics industry is transitioning from a focus on speed differentiation to a more complex competitive landscape, with companies like JD Logistics and SF Express adopting different strategies to maintain market share [1][2][3] Group 1: Company Performance - JD Logistics reported a revenue of 46.967 billion yuan in Q1, representing a year-on-year growth of 11.5%, with a net profit of 0.451 billion yuan, up 89.1% [1] - The revenue from JD Logistics' integrated supply chain clients reached 23.2 billion yuan in Q1, growing by 13.2% year-on-year, accounting for nearly 50% of total revenue [3] - SF Express achieved a revenue of 69.85 billion yuan in Q1, with a year-on-year increase of 6.9%, and a net profit of 2.234 billion yuan, up 16.87% [7] Group 2: Strategic Initiatives - JD Logistics is focusing on deep integration with manufacturing and various industry segments, moving away from traditional express delivery competition [3] - The company has over 3,600 self-operated warehouses and cloud warehouses, with a total management area exceeding 32 million square meters [2] - JD Logistics is implementing advanced technologies, such as the "Super Brain" model, to enhance operational efficiency and ensure smooth delivery of products under national subsidy programs [5][6] Group 3: Market Trends - The logistics market is experiencing intensified competition, with companies seeking to avoid reliance on price wars while maintaining market share [2][3] - The rise of e-commerce has significantly influenced the logistics sector, leading to a saturated market where differentiation is increasingly challenging [2] - JD Logistics is expanding its overseas operations, with plans to exceed 1 million square feet of overseas warehouse space by 2025, and has already established over 20 overseas warehouses in Europe [6][7]

Investment Rating - The investment rating for the transportation industry is "Positive" (maintained) [4] Core Views - The shipping industry is experiencing a surge in demand due to a recent temporary reduction in tariffs between China and the US, leading to a significant increase in shipping volumes on the US route. The average booking volume surged by 277% compared to the previous week [5] - The Shanghai Export Container Freight Index (SCFI) rose by 10.0% week-on-week, indicating a strong recovery in shipping rates, particularly for routes to the US [6] - The logistics sector is showing resilience, with express delivery volumes in April increasing by 19.1% year-on-year, reflecting robust demand across various sectors [9] - The airline industry is expected to benefit from macroeconomic recovery, with a long-term supply-demand imbalance favoring growth in the sector [12] Summary by Sections Shipping Vessels - The recent tariff reductions have led to a surge in demand for shipping services, particularly on the US route, with a projected increase in freight rates over the next 2-3 months due to supply constraints [5] - The average weekly capacity for the US route is expected to be 500,000 TEU, down 6% from last year [5] - The oil tanker market is facing supply tightness due to limited new orders and an aging fleet, which is expected to sustain high demand in the coming years [12] Express Logistics - In April, the express delivery industry in China saw a business volume of 16.32 billion pieces, a year-on-year increase of 19.1%, with revenue reaching 121.28 billion yuan, up 10.8% [9] - The concentration index for express delivery brands (CR8) was 86.7, indicating a stable competitive landscape [9] Aviation and Airports - The airline industry is poised for growth due to low supply growth and recovering demand, with key companies to watch including China Southern Airlines and Air China [12] - The passenger transport volume in March was approximately 59 million, reflecting a year-on-year increase of 3.5% [50] Overall Market Performance - From May 12 to May 16, the transportation index rose by 2.12%, outperforming the Shanghai Composite Index [17] - The shipping sector saw the highest increase at 7.42%, indicating strong market performance [17]

Core Viewpoint - The Guangdong provincial government is actively promoting the sales of lychee during the peak season, focusing on addressing bottlenecks in the production, supply, and sales chain to enhance the quality and efficiency of the lychee industry [2][3][4]. Group 1: Industry Development - The provincial agricultural department is coordinating efforts to resolve key issues in the lychee sales process, aiming for high-quality development of the lychee industry [3][4]. - The government is implementing a three-year plan to achieve initial results in the "Hundred Counties, Thousand Towns, and Ten Thousand Villages High-Quality Development Project" [4]. Group 2: Production and Sales - The Dayrise Cooperative, a national-level farmer professional cooperative, has a lychee planting area of 15,000 acres, primarily growing the "Feizixiao" variety, with an annual sales volume of nearly 10,000 tons [14][15]. - The cooperative has pre-sold about 5,000 tons of "Feizixiao" lychee and expects to export over 2,000 tons to countries including the USA, Canada, Australia, and Russia [16][17]. - The company Mingjing Agricultural Development primarily exports lychee to markets in Hebei, Xinjiang, Zhejiang, Henan, and Hunan, with confidence in the pricing during the peak season [18]. Group 3: Logistics and Transportation - Cold chain logistics is crucial for lychee sales due to the fruit's short shelf life and transportation challenges [20][21]. - Logistics companies like SF Express and JD Logistics are setting up over 2,000 collection points and arranging dedicated flights for lychee air transport, as well as opening land transport lines to ensure timely delivery [24][25]. - The government emphasizes the need to strengthen cold storage facilities and reduce logistics costs to enhance the overall efficiency of lychee distribution [29][30]. Group 4: Marketing Strategies - The government is advocating for the development of a "Lychee Procurement Map" and a directory of buyers to strengthen the marketing system [36][37]. - Innovative marketing strategies, including collaborations with social media platforms and e-commerce sites, are being promoted to expand sales channels and enhance consumer engagement [38][39]. - The initiative includes creating diverse consumption scenarios and developing various lychee products to increase value and boost farmers' income [42][46].

Core Viewpoint - JD Logistics reported 1Q25 results that met expectations, with revenue growth driven by increased investment in product competitiveness and a focus on medium to long-term profit growth [1]. Revenue Performance - Total revenue for 1Q25 increased by 11% YoY to Rmb46.97 billion, with non-IFRS net profit rising 13% YoY to Rmb751 million [1]. - Revenue from the integrated supply chain business grew 13% YoY to Rmb23.2 billion, with JD.com contributing Rmb14.7 billion, a 14% YoY increase [2]. - Revenue from external customers rose 12% YoY to Rmb8.5 billion, with the number of customers increasing by 14% YoY to 63,601 [3]. - Revenue from express delivery and freight delivery industries increased by 10% YoY to Rmb23.8 billion, maintaining a high external revenue proportion of about 70% [4]. Cost and Expense Analysis - Operating costs rose 12% YoY, with specific increases in employee compensation (+14%), outsourcing costs (+18%), and other operating costs (+6%) [5]. - Gross margin decreased by 0.5 percentage points YoY to 7.2%, attributed to increased investments in transportation and delivery resources [5]. - Total expenses rose 1.3% YoY to Rmb3.18 billion, with the expense proportion in revenue decreasing by 0.7 percentage points to 6.8% [5]. Future Trends and Growth Drivers - The company is expected to enter a development phase in 2025, focusing on scale expansion and product upgrades, driven by channel integration with the Taotian platform and improvements in operational efficiency [6]. - Expansion of overseas warehouses is anticipated to unlock new market opportunities for the international business [7]. - Integration with Deppon's network is expected to enhance economies of scale [7]. Financial Forecast and Valuation - The non-IFRS net profit forecast for 2025 has been raised by 35% to Rmb8.54 billion, with a new forecast for 2026 at Rmb9.43 billion, reflecting a 10% YoY increase [7]. - The stock is currently trading at 8.5x 2025e and 7.6x 2026e non-IFRS P/E, with a target price of HK$18.5, indicating a potential upside of 57.3% [7].
